Abstract
A method and apparatus for monitoring the performance of a dedicated communications medium in a switched data networking environment wherein a probe having a bypass circuit allows promiscuous monitoring of all traffic between a switch and a network device, such as a file server, in either direction, and in full duplex mode. Additionally, the bypass circuit eliminates the requirement for a separate repeater between the switch and the network device.

6. A probe comprising:
-
a first port to communicatively couple with a first network device; a second port to communicatively couple with a second network device; a bypass circuit to couple the first port to the second port to forward communications received from the first network device via the first port to the second network device via the second port when power to the probe is interrupted, said bypass circuit comprising a relay to alternately couple the first port to the second port, or the first port and the second port to a repeater; and a monitor to couple to the repeater to receive and monitor the communications forwarded from the first port to the second port via the repeater when the power to the probe is not interrupted. - View Dependent Claims (7)
